Method for coating at least one fiber with boron nitride intermediate phase
The invention relates to a method for coating at least one fiber (11) with a boron nitride intermediate phase, comprising treating said at least one fiber with a treatment medium containing ammonia borane, said treatment medium having a temperature of 100 DEG C or higher and a pressure of 1 bar or higher.
